Dr. Jonathan Gruber, MIT Economist and Health Reform Architect

This week on Conversations on Health Care, hosts Mark Masselli and Margaret Flinter discuss health care reform with MIT Health Economist Dr. Jonathan Gruber, one of the chief architects of health care reform in Massachusetts, and a significant contributor to the development of the Affordable Care Act health reform legislation. Dr. Gruber discusses the economics underlying health reform, and his recent “graphic novel,” Health Care Reform: What it is, Why it’s Necessary, How it Works, which translates complex legislation into simple terms for consumers.
